Badass kicker becomes first woman to earn NCAA football scholarship

TwitterFacebook

College football got a little more interesting this year. 

One high school senior just made history by becoming the first female to receive a football scholarship at an NCAA Division II school or higher.

Becca Longo signed with Adams State University in Colorado as a kicker - the same position she played at Basha High School in Arizona. About a dozen women have played football for NCAA schools but none on a scholarship, CNN reported.

Upon hearing that she was the first NCAA scholarship player, Longo said she was "completely shocked." Read more...
